Information about Spain
Spain is a country of Western Europe and one of the major
European countries. Located in the west - southwest tip of
Europe and occupies almost 84% of the Iberian peninsula (the
remaining 16% occupied by Portugal). It belongs to the north and
for the most part, in the western hemisphere and its position
defined by the coordinates: 35 ° 39 - 43 ° 45 north latitude by
4 ° 25 east to 9 ° 20 west longitude . The perimeter of the
Iberian area of Spain is 4,780 km, of which 1654 km occupy its
borders and 3126 km (65%) of the coastline. Spain is bordered to
the west by Portugal, whilst in the north and northeast of the
Pyrenees Mountains it is separate from France and the state of
Andorra. It borders to the east and southeast with the
Mediterranean and north, west and southwest by the Atlantic
Ocean. In the south-eastern tip is the small peninsula of
Gibraltar that since 1713 is under British possession. Through
the Gibraltar straights joins the Atlantic Ocean with the
Mediterranean Sea and separated Spain - and by extension Europe
from Morocco and Africa. In Spain belong also some small islands
lying off the coast of Morocco, the Balearic Islands (Mallorca,
Menorca, Ibiza, Formentera and Cabrera) in the Mediterranean Sea
and the Canary Islands (Tenerife, Las Palmas, Hierro, Gkomara,
Gran Canaria, Lanzarote, Fuerteventura) in the Atlantic Ocean.
Spain from the 16th to the 19th century was the center of a
great empire, which occupied most of South and Central America
(except Brazil).
The total area of Spain is 504,782 sq. km and the country ranks
4th in Europe in terms of size (after Russia, Ukraine and
France) and 50th in the world. It is about twice the size of the
United Kingdom and 3.8 times larger than Greece. Occupies 5% of
the area of Europe, while only 2.7% of its total area is the
island's terrain.
The total population amounts to 40,525,100 inhabitants about.
Spain ranks seventh in Europe in terms of population (after
Russia, Germany, Italy, France, the United Kingdom and Ukraine)
and 28th in the world.
Spain's capital and largest urban centre in the country is
Madrid. The main town occupies an area of 66 sq. km and has a
population of approximately 3,020,000 inhabitants. It is
situated at the centre of the Iberian peninsula, on the river
Manthanares at an altitude of 690 meters and is the economic,
political and cultural centre of the country. The attractions
include the Mayor Square (1617), the Royal Palace in the 18th
century. The Prado Museum, the National Archaeological Museum,
the Modern Art Centre and many buildings built in baroque style.
Second largest city in the country is Barcelona, the capital of
an autonomous administrative region of Catalonia. It is built on
the north-eastern Mediterranean coast and has 1,650,000
inhabitants (1998). The major urban area has more than 3,000,000
inhabitants. The city has major museums, libraries and major
historical monuments, among which stand out the Town Hall, the
Cathedral of Sangri Familia (Holy Evlalia) and the church of
Santa Maria del Mar (14th century)..
Third most populous city in the country is Valencia, located on
the Mediterranean coast south of Barcelona. It is built on the
banks of the Guadalquivir River and is the administrative
capital of the homonymous district. Its population is
approximately 760,000 inhabitants, while the greater
metropolitan area has approximately 2,120,000 inhabitants. Local
attractions include the Courthouse, the fortified gates, the
cathedral of the 14th century and The Museum of Fine Arts.
The city of Seville, capital of the administrative region of
Andalusia. Built on the banks of the river Gouantalkivir is a
river port and one of the most important Spanish cities in
architectural monuments and attractions, among which stand the
medieval fortress of Alcatraz, which was built by the Moors in
1181, and the cathedral of the 15th century and the minaret
Giralda, which reaches a height of 91 m.
Fifth-largest city of Spain is Zaragoza (600,000-way. 1998),
which is located in the north-eastern part of the country on the
banks of the river Ebro, is the capital of Aragon. The
university was founded in 1474, while the city is full of
historic buildings, among which stand the church of Our Lady of
Pilar 17th century. The Gothic Cathedral, the Tower of
Alchaferias and Loncha, Renaissance style.
Malaga, which is valuable port and large tourist resort on the
southern coast in the Mediterranean. Bilbao is the seventh most
populous city in Spain. Located in the northern part of the
country, in the Basque country, and through Canal Nervion
communicates with the Bay of Biscay. It is one of the largest
industrial centres of the country. The city of Las Palmas in the
Canary Islands with a population of 360,000 inhabitants, built
on the northeast coast of the island of Gran Canaria, major
commercial and tourist center.
Other large cities are Valladolid town of the region of Castilla
- Leon, Murcia the capital of the eponymous administrative
district, the historic capital of the Arab Caliphate of Cordoba
Ommefadon, famous for its Alcazar and mosque built by the Moors,
the Palma de Mallorca, capital of the Balearic Islands and a
large tourist center in the Mediterranean, Vigo, the country's
major port on the west coast of the Iberian in the Atlantic,
Alicante, the port in the south-eastern Mediterranean coast and
center Export of agricultural products in the region, Gijon, a
major port of northern Spain, Granada, famous for its palace of
the Alhambra, La Coruna , in north-western tip of the Iberian,
Badalona in Catalonia, Santa Cruz and Tenerife on the island of
Tenerife in the Canary Islands, Cadiz, a large port in southern
Spain in the Atlantic and one of the oldest cities (founded in
1100 BC by the Phoenicians), Almeria, Santander and San
Sebastian on the Bay of Biscay, Toledo, capital of the
administrative region of New Castile and old capital of Spain.
